Transaction 62980a1f61873cfab82181ebddac59fb9d389973270805ff786b65ef6598b41a

1 Input
2 Outputs
  • 62980a1f61873cfab82181ebddac59fb9d389973270805ff786b65ef6598b41a:0
  • value  672915
    address  3JKqWYUtCA8Th4fKmrLDGHXUsrKtoo7UrF
  • 62980a1f61873cfab82181ebddac59fb9d389973270805ff786b65ef6598b41a:1
  • value  119599
    address  1umC7tBnd5yAdb4gwQCwGriXA7axPSGw7